Sinn Fein, SDLP to have electoral pact talks
Sinn Fein and the SDLP are to begin talks next week on possible electoral pacts for the forthcoming British general election.
Sinn Fein national chairman Mitchel McLaughlin said he had received a letter from his SDLP counterpart Alex Atwood agreeing to discussions.
Both parties are believed to be targeting Ulster Unionist Party-held seats in West Tyrone, Fermanagh/South Tyrone, North Belfast and South Belfast.
